1-1. Scope and Purpose of This Manual


This manual provides instructions for installing and operating the following turbocharged
aircraft engines, referred to collectively as the “TSIO-550 Series” engines, manufactured
by Teledyne Continental Motors (TCM):
• TSIO-550-B
• TSIO-550-C
• TSIO-550-E
• TSIO-550-G

Instructions in this manual are specific to the TSIO-550 Series engines. For information
specific to other TCM engine series, accessories, or the airplane, refer to the appropriate
manual. Chapters are arranged in sequential order to install, test, and operate the engine.

Chapter 2 contains engine description and specifications. Chapter 4 provides installation


instructions and illustrations for installing the engine. Chapter 5 identifies inspection,
service intervals, and operational tests. Chapter 6 contains engine storage instructions and
steps to return a stored engine to operation. Chapter 7 provides supplemental information
for the airplane flight manual (AFM) and pilot operating handbook (POH) in regards to
specific engine operating procedures. Appendix A contains a glossary of common terms
and acronyms used throughout the manual; Appendix B provides torque specifications,
and Appendix C contains standard maintenance practices.
1-1.1. Advisories
This manual utilizes three types of advisories; defined as follows:

WARNING

A warning emphasizes information which, if disregarded,


could result in severe injury to personnel or equipment failure.

CAUTION: Emphasizes certain information or instructions, which if


disregarded, may result in damage to the engine or accessories.

NOTE: Provides special interest information, which may facilitate


performance of a procedure or operation of equipment.
Warnings and cautions precede the steps to which they apply; notes are placed in the
manner which provides the greatest clarity. Warnings, cautions, and notes do not impose
undue restrictions. Failure to heed advisories will likely result in the undesirable or
unsafe conditions the advisory was intended to prevent. Advisories are inserted to ensure
maximum safety, efficiency, and performance. Abuse, misuse, or neglect of equipment
can cause eventual engine malfunction or failure.

1-1.3. Compliance
The owner/operator and designated mechanic are responsible for ensuring the engine is
maintained in an airworthy condition, including compliance with applicable service
documents and FAA Airworthiness Directives. Engine service life is calculated based on
compliance with the aircraft and engine manufacturer’s required instructions, inspections,
and maintenance schedule. Failure to comply may void the engine warranty.

WARNING

Prior to authorizing engine installation or maintenance, the


owner must ensure the mechanic meets the requirements of
FAR 65 and must comply with FAR parts 43, 91, and 145, as
applicable.
Except for FAR part 43.3 authorized owner maintenance, TCM ICAs are written for
exclusive use by FAA (or equivalent authority) licensed mechanics or FAA (or
equivalent authority) certified repair center employees working under the supervision of
an FAA licensed mechanic. Information and instructions contained in this manual
anticipate the user possesses and applies the knowledge, training, and experience
commensurate with the requirements to meet the prerequisite FAA license and
certification requirements. No other use is authorized.

1-2. Publications
1-2.1. Service Documents
Six categories of Service Documents may be issued by TCM ranging from mandatory
(Category 1) to informational (Category 6). Definitions of the categories are listed below:

NOTE: Upon FAA approval, all TCM service documents are


published and available on TCMLINK. Service Documents which
contain updates to the Instructions for Continued Airworthiness must
be inserted in the affected manual until such time the manual is revised
to include the Service Document Instructions or the Service Document
is cancelled or superseded. Affected manuals will be referenced in all
Service Documents containing updates to the manufacturer’s
Instructions for Continued Airworthiness.
Procedure
Category 1: Mandatory Service Bulletin (MSB)
Used to identify and correct a known or suspected safety hazard which has been incorporated
in whole or in part into an Airworthiness Directive (AD) issued by the FAA or have been
issued at the direction of the FAA by the manufacturer requiring compliance with an already-
issued AD (or an equivalent issued by another country’s airworthiness authority). May contain
updates to TCM’s Instructions for Continued Airworthiness to address a safety issue.
Category 2: Critical Service Bulletin (CSB)
This category identifies a condition that threatens continued safe operation of an aircraft,
persons or property on the ground unless some specific action (inspection, repair, replacement,
etc.) is taken by the owner or operator. Documents in this category are candidates for
incorporation into an FAA Airworthiness Directive. May contain updates to TCM’s
Instructions for Continued Airworthiness to address a safety issue.
Category 3: Service Bulletin (SB)
Information which the product manufacturer believes may improve the inherent safety of an
aircraft or aircraft component; this category includes the most recent updates to Instructions
for Continued Airworthiness.
Category 4: Service Information Directive (SID)
The manufacturer directs the owner/operator/mechanic in the use of a product to enhance
safety, maintenance or economy. May contain updates to TCM’s Instructions for Continued
Airworthiness in the form of maintenance procedures or specifications.
Category 5: Service Information Letter (SIL)
This category includes all information (not included in categories 1 through 4) that may be
useful to the owner/operator/technician. May contain updates to TCM’s Instructions for
Continued Airworthiness for optional component installations, which are not covered in the
Applicable Operator, Maintenance, or Overhaul Manuals.
Category 6: Special Service Instruction (SSI)
This category is used to address an issue limited to specific model and/or serial number
engines. TCM will distribute SSI notification directly to the affected engine’s owners. SSIs
will not be included in the general service document set but will be made available through

TSIO-550 Permold Series Engine Installation and Operation Manual 1-5


29 November 2006
TM

Introduction Teledyne Continental Motors, Inc.

TCM Customer Service to owners of the affected engines only. An SSI may contain updates
to the Instructions for Continued Airworthiness applicable to the listed engines.

Teledyne Continental Motors releases publication changes in the form of either change
pages or complete publication revisions, depending upon the extent of change. Service
Documents may supplement or replace technical information contained in one
publication or an entire series of publications. Such Service Documents represent a
change to the published ICA until the individual publications incorporate the latest
technical information.
1-2.4.1. Update/Change Distribution
Updates are available via TCMLINK upon notification of FAA document approval. TCM
notifies engine owners of technical publication changes free of charge. TCM notifies
current TCMLINK service subscribers by mail as publications are updated. Current
subscribers receive a complete publication library on CD delivered quarterly. Printed
publication subscribers receive printed changes and revisions as they are released.
